在当前的数字化时代,混合移动交互技术已经成为网络游戏领域的一个重要组成部分。标题“网络游戏-用于本地应用和网络应用的混合移动交互.zip”暗示了这个压缩包包含的资源专注于探讨如何将本地应用与网络应用的特性结合,以提升移动游戏的用户体验。这种混合模式允许游戏在离线和在线环境下都能提供流畅、互动的游戏体验。
描述中提到的“网络游戏-用于本地应用和网络应用的混合移动交互.zip”进一步强调了主题,即文件内容可能包括关于如何设计和实现这种交互方式的理论、实践案例和最佳实践。这种混合交互方式在解决网络不稳定问题、提高游戏性能以及实现社交功能等方面具有显著优势。
标签“资料”表明压缩包中的内容可能是研究报告、教程、案例分析或者代码示例等教育资源,对于开发者、设计师和对游戏开发感兴趣的个人来说具有很高的学习价值。
“用于本地应用和网络应用的混合移动交互.pdf”是压缩包内的主要文件,我们可预期这是一份详细的文档,涵盖了以下关键知识点:
1. **混合移动应用的基本概念**:解释混合移动应用的含义,它是如何结合原生应用的性能优势和Web应用的跨平台能力的。
2. **网络游戏架构**:阐述网络游戏的基本架构,包括客户端、服务器端以及它们之间的通信协议。
3. **离线模式的设计**:讨论如何在无网络连接时仍能保持游戏进度和用户体验,例如通过本地数据存储和同步机制。
4. **网络状态管理**:介绍如何处理网络波动和断网情况,确保游戏的连续性和稳定性。
5. **实时交互优化**:讨论减少延迟和提高响应速度的技术,如UDP(用户数据报协议)和TCP(传输控制协议)的选择,以及多线程和异步编程的应用。
6. **社交功能集成**:说明如何在混合应用中实现好友系统、排行榜和聊天功能,增强玩家间的互动。
7. **性能优化**:探讨如何优化图形渲染、内存管理以及计算效率,以适应移动设备的硬件限制。
8. **安全性与隐私保护**:讲解如何保护用户数据安全,防止作弊和非法入侵,以及遵循的数据隐私政策。
9. **开发工具和框架**:推荐用于混合移动应用开发的工具,如React Native、Cordova或Flutter,以及用于网络游戏开发的库和框架。
10. **案例研究**:可能包含实际游戏项目的案例分析,展示成功应用混合移动交互的例子。
11. **最佳实践和未来趋势**:总结现有的最佳实践,并预测混合移动交互在网络游戏领域的未来发展趋势。
这份资料对于深入理解网络游戏的混合移动交互设计至关重要,无论是新手还是经验丰富的开发者,都能从中获取宝贵的知识和启示,以提升其游戏开发技能。